“…Figure 1(a) shows the parameterization of computational models. The dimensions of the parent artery and aneurysm were used as parameters [22][23][24]. The diameter of the parent artery (D) was 4.0 × 10 −3 m and the length (L) was 0.29 m. The radius of curvature (λ) of the parent artery was 6.0 × 10 −3 m and was calculated with a Dean number of 46.…”
